Text函数的使用方法:从基础到高级应用
Text函数的使用方法:从基础到高级应用
Text函数是许多编程语言和软件中常见的一个功能,它允许用户将数据转换为特定的文本格式。在本文中,我们将详细探讨Text函数的使用方法,并列举一些常见的应用场景。
Text函数的基本用法
Text函数的基本语法通常如下:
TEXT(value, format)
其中,value
是要格式化的数据,format
是指定的格式字符串。例如,在Excel中,你可以使用TEXT
函数将日期格式化为特定的文本格式:
=TEXT(A1, "yyyy-mm-dd")
这里,A1
单元格中的日期将被格式化为“年-月-日”的形式。
常见的格式字符串
-
日期和时间:
yyyy
表示年份,mm
表示月份,dd
表示日期,hh
表示小时,mm
表示分钟,ss
表示秒。例如:TEXT(TODAY(), "yyyy年mm月dd日")
将当前日期格式化为“2023年10月15日”。
-
数字:
0
表示数字占位符,#
表示可选数字,.
表示小数点。例如:TEXT(1234.567, "0.00")
将数字格式化为“1234.57”。TEXT(1234.567, "#,##0.00")
将数字格式化为“1,234.57”。
Text函数的高级应用
-
数据清洗:在数据处理中,Text函数可以用于清洗和标准化数据。例如,将不同格式的日期统一为一种格式,或者将数字统一为特定的小数位数。
-
报告生成:在生成报告时,Text函数可以帮助你将数据以更易读的方式呈现。例如,在财务报表中,你可以使用Text函数将金额格式化为货币格式:
=TEXT(B2, "$#,##0.00")
-
动态文本生成:在一些动态文本生成的场景中,Text函数可以根据条件生成不同的文本。例如,在邮件模板中根据用户的不同情况生成个性化内容。
-
数据验证:通过Text函数,你可以验证数据是否符合特定的格式要求。例如,检查一个字符串是否为有效的日期格式。
应用实例
-
Excel中的应用:在Excel中,Text函数可以用于日期、时间、数字的格式化。例如,在销售报表中,你可以将销售日期统一格式化,以便于后续的数据分析。
-
VBA编程:在VBA(Visual Basic for Applications)中,Text函数可以用于字符串操作和数据格式化。例如:
Dim formattedDate As String formattedDate = Format(Date, "yyyy-mm-dd")
-
Web开发:在JavaScript中,
toLocaleString()
方法可以看作是Text函数的一种实现,用于将日期和数字格式化为本地化的文本。
注意事项
- 文化差异:不同地区对日期、时间和数字的格式有不同的习惯,使用Text函数时需要考虑这些差异。
- 性能:在处理大量数据时,频繁使用Text函数可能会影响性能,因此在批量处理时应考虑优化策略。
通过以上介绍,我们可以看到Text函数在数据处理、报告生成、动态文本生成等方面都有广泛的应用。无论你是数据分析师、程序员还是普通用户,掌握Text函数的使用方法都能大大提高你的工作效率和数据处理能力。希望本文对你有所帮助,祝你在数据处理的道路上顺利前行!